Pesquisa de site

Como instalar o PHP 8.3 no RHEL 9 Linux


PHP é uma linguagem de programação popular usada para construir aplicativos web dinâmicos. Com o lançamento do PHP 8.3, os desenvolvedores ganham acesso a novos recursos e melhorias.

Para este guia, operaremos o sistema como root, se este não for o seu caso, use o comando sudo para adquirir privilégios de root.

Etapa 1: atualizar pacotes do sistema

Para instalar a versão mais recente do PHP, primeiro você precisa atualizar o repositório de pacotes do seu sistema e instalar os pacotes mais recentes disponíveis usando o comando dnf.

sudo dnf update

Etapa 2: Habilitar o Repositório EPEL no RHEL

Em seguida, instale o pacote epel-release, que fornece pacotes adicionais para o sistema RHEL.

sudo subscription-manager repos --enable codeready-builder-for-rhel-9-$(arch)-rpms
sudo dnf install https://dl.fedoraproject.org/pub/epel/epel-release-latest-9.noarch.rpm

Etapa 3: Habilitar o Repositório Remi no RHEL

Em seguida, você precisa habilitar o repositório Remi que oferece as versões mais recentes do PHP para sistemas RHEL.

sudo dnf install https://rpms.remirepo.net/enterprise/remi-release-9.rpm

Etapa 4: Instale o PHP 8.3 no RHEL

Agora você pode instalar o PHP 8.3 junto com as extensões necessárias.

sudo dnf module install php:remi-8.3

Depois de instalado, você pode verificar a instalação do PHP.

php -v

Etapa 5: instale extensões PHP adicionais (opcional)

Dependendo dos requisitos do seu projeto, pode ser necessário instalar extensões PHP adicionais.

sudo dnf search php-*

A seguir, instale as extensões desejadas usando:

sudo dnf install php-gd php-xml

Se você estiver usando Apache ou Nginx como servidor web, reinicie-o para aplicar as alterações.

sudo systemctl restart httpd
Or
sudo systemctl restart nginx

Por último, abaixo está uma lista de artigos úteis sobre PHP que você pode ler para obter informações adicionais:

  • Como usar e executar códigos PHP na linha de comando do Linux
  • Como encontrar arquivos de configuração MySQL, PHP e Apache
  • Como testar a conexão do banco de dados PHP MySQL usando script
  • Como executar script PHP como usuário normal com Cron

Você instalou com sucesso o PHP 8.3 em seu sistema RHEL 9. Agora você pode começar a desenvolver ou hospedar aplicações web usando a versão mais recente do PHP, aproveitando seus novos recursos e melhorias.